Just-in-time production is a production system that emphasizes the production of goods to meet actual current demand, thus minimizing the need to hold inventories of finished goods and work-in-process at each stage of the supply chain.
Social Learning Theory
A theory that proposes people can learn new behaviors and norms through observational learning, by watching and imitating others.
Classical Conditioning
An educational method where two signals are frequently combined, leading to a response initially triggered by the second signal being provoked by just the first signal over time.
Psychoanalytic
A therapeutic approach and theory of psychology that emphasizes unconscious mental processes and childhood experiences in shaping behavior and personality.
Cognitive
Pertaining to mental processes such as thinking, learning, memory, and problem-solving.
